The Chief Magistrates Court sitting in the Okitipupa area of Ondo State on Friday remanded a 25-year-old man, Ayo Ajibade, in Okitipupa Correctional Centre for allegedly stealing four tubers of yam valued at N10,000.
The Chief Magistrate, Mayowa Olanipekun, remanded Ajibade until January 29, 2026, pending the determination of his judgement, after pleading guilty to a two-count charge bordering on felony and stealing.
Earlier, the prosecutor, ASP Ayodeji Omoyeigha, told the court that the defendant and one other at large conspired to commit felony at Kiribo in Igbekebo on October 25, 2025.

Omoyeigha disclosed that the 25-year-old man and one other at large entered the farm belonging to one Olorunjuwon Igbasan at about 5:00 a.m. and stole the tubers of yam.
Omoyeigha added that the offence contravenes and is punishable under Sections 516 and 390 (9), Criminal Code, Cap.37, Vol. 1, Laws of Ondo State, 2006.
